Gateway Transportation is a general freight carrier head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ri. Gateway Transportation reports over 65 drivers and 50 trucks, and Gateway drivers logged over 5,370,000 miles in 2010.
With that many Gateway Transportation truckers driving millions of miles per year, serious work injuries happen. Highway accidents alone are a serious risk. In the 24 months prior to September 10, 2011, Gateway Transportation reported 3 crashes to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) with all 3 resulting in injuries.
